Compostable Dish Brush Refill
Elevate your dishwashing routine with the Compostable Dish Brush Refill from Andrée Jardin. Designed for seamless integration with the French Beech Wood Handled Dish Brush (sold separately), this refill head offers an effective and eco-conscious cleaning solution. Crafted from natural vegetable fibers and French beech wood, it honors traditional brush-making techniques. Made in France, this refill is completely compostable, providing a zero-waste option for your kitchen essentials. Each refill is sold individually, embodying Andrée Jardin's commitment to durable, useful, and beautiful home goods.

What customers say
Customers overwhelmingly value the Andrée Jardin Compostable Dish Brush Refill for its strong commitment to sustainability and natural quality. The compostable heads are highly appreciated as an ethical upgrade from plastic. Reviewers frequently praise the brush’s attractive design, which enhances the kitchen aesthetic. Functionally, the natural fiber bristles effectively scrub tough residue without scratching surfaces, and replacing the refill is simple. While the initial cost is higher, the core audience prioritizes alignment with environmental values. A minor drawback noted is that the natural fibers may wear faster than synthetic options, requiring more frequent replacement. Overall satisfaction remains very high due to the product's eco-conscious appeal.
